A DUI CAN JEOPARDIZE YOUR PROFESSIONAL LICENSE
If you hold a professional license, just being arrested for DUI may impact your ability to practice your profession. Many licensing boards require the self-reporting of arrests. The reporting and conviction of a DUI can lead to fines, probation, and even suspension of your professional license. You may also be required to be evaluated by the South Carolina Recovering Professionals Program (SCRPP) and be required to enroll for up to five years.
